ModernCPlusPlusDemo
载入中...
搜索中...
未找到
Public 成员函数 | 静态 Public 成员函数 | Protected 成员函数 | 所有成员列表
Singleton< T > 模板类 参考

#include <Singleton.hpp>

Public 成员函数

 Singleton (const Singleton &)=delete
 
Singletonoperator= (const Singleton &)=delete
 
 Singleton (Singleton &&)=delete
 
Singletonoperator= (Singleton &&)=delete
 

静态 Public 成员函数

static T & s_getInstance ()
 

Protected 成员函数

 Singleton ()=default
 
 ~Singleton ()=default
 

构造及析构函数说明

◆ Singleton() [1/3]

template<typename T >
Singleton< T >::Singleton ( const Singleton< T > &  )
delete

◆ Singleton() [2/3]

template<typename T >
Singleton< T >::Singleton ( Singleton< T > &&  )
delete

◆ Singleton() [3/3]

template<typename T >
Singleton< T >::Singleton ( )
protecteddefault

◆ ~Singleton()

template<typename T >
Singleton< T >::~Singleton ( )
protecteddefault

成员函数说明

◆ operator=() [1/2]

template<typename T >
Singleton & Singleton< T >::operator= ( const Singleton< T > &  )
delete

◆ operator=() [2/2]

template<typename T >
Singleton & Singleton< T >::operator= ( Singleton< T > &&  )
delete

◆ s_getInstance()

template<typename T >
static T & Singleton< T >::s_getInstance ( )
inlinestatic

该类的文档由以下文件生成: